This classic of post-Civil War Southern cooking, designed to aid well-to-do women forced into their kitchens for the first time with the end of slavery, is a charming example of education in the domestic arts in the late 19th century. In her stern but helpful manner, ANNABELLA P. HILL (1810-1878) guides her fellow homemakers—and those today seeking a soupçon of old-style Southern elegance—in lessons on how to: – pickle shrimps – prepare mutton to imitate venison – bake a pig – make liver pudding – make barbecue sauce – make succotash – tenderize tough meat – make Irish potato yeast – preserve figs – make molasses candy – and much more. With further instruction on other housekeeping chores, such as soapmaking and the preparation of medicines, this is an enlightening peek into the mundane chores of a bygone age.
